Chinnor Road is in Towersey, Thame and in South Oxfordshire district. OX9 3QY is located in the Chinnor elect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Henley.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Is Chinnor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Chinnor Road was 39.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 7.8% higher than the Chinnor average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Chinnor Road has the 11th highest crime rate of 26 local areas in Chinnor and the 210th highest crime rate of 456 local areas in South Oxfordshire .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 22.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-15.1%.

Employment

OX9 3QY area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 7%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 16%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

OX9 3QY area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
